- The "Tight Hijab" Debate: Many ABGs wear tight jeans or leggings under a long tunic and a thin, translucent pashmina that reveals the shape of the neck or chest. This is often criticized by conservative clerics as "hijab but not hijab"—fulfilling the letter but not the spirit of modesty.
- Social Issue: Internal Conflict and Hypocrisy Accusations: The ABG may feel torn between looking fashionable for her peers (and social media followers) and following stricter religious interpretations. She might be accused of being a hijabers gaul (stylish hijaber) who parties, has boyfriends, and posts selfies—behaviors traditionally seen as contradictory to wearing the jilbab. This leads to a crisis of authenticity: is she a pious Muslim first, or a trendy teenager first?
